红河州人为源挥发性有机物排放清单及特征

Emission Inventory and Characteristics of Volatile Organic Compounds from Anthropogenic Sources in Honghe

  • 摘要: 收集红河州人为源挥发性有机物排放活动水平数据,建立了2017年红河州人为源挥发性有机物排放清单,结果表明:2017年红河州人为源VOCS排放量为65191t,其中生物质燃烧源、化石燃料源、工艺过程源、溶剂使用源和移动源排放量分别为7760、5016、14109、29530和8776t,分担率分别为11.9%、7.69%、21.64%、45.30%和13.46%。沥青铺路是溶剂使用源的最大贡献源;酒的制造、肥料制造和加油站是重点工业排放源,占工艺过程源的63.4%;移动源排放量最大来源为摩托车,占比71.67%;生物质燃烧源的最主要源是生物质露天燃烧,占比为66.53%;化石燃料源的最大来源是工业和居民燃煤排放,占比为90.73%。各县市人为源VOCS排放量呈现出以红河为界的两级分化,蒙自、个旧、开远、弥勒等北部7县市VOCS排放占比77%,元阳、红河、绿春等南部6县VOCS排放占比23%。

     

    Abstract: Based on the data of emission level and emission factors of VOCs from man-made sources in Honghe Prefecture, the emission inventory of VOCs from man-made sources in 2017 was established. The results showed that the VOCs emission from man-made sources in 2017 was 65191t, including 7760t, 5016t, 14109t, and 8776t from biomass combustion sources, fossil fuel sources, process sources, solvent use sources and mobile sources, respectively.The share rates were 11.9%, 7.69%, 21.64%, 45.30%, and 13.46%, respectively. Asphalt paving is the largest contribution source of solvent use; alcohol manufacturing, fertilizer manufacturing and gas stations are the key industrial emission sources, accounting for 63.4% of the process sources; the largest source of mobile emissions is motorcycles, accounting for 71.67%; the main source of biomass combustion is biomass open combustion, accounting for 66.53%; the largest source of fossil fuel is industrial and residential coal emissions, The proportion is 90.73%. The VOCs emission from human sources in each county and city showed a two-level differentiation with the Red River as the boundary. The VOCs emission of 7 counties and cities in the north of Mengzi, Gejiu, Kaiyuan and Maitreya accounted for 77%, and the VOCs emission of 6 counties in the south of Yuanyang, Honghe and Lvchun accounted for 23%.
